Financials Schroder Real Estate Investment Trust Limited

Equities

SREI

GB00B01HM147

Diversified REITs

Market Closed - London S.E. 11:35:11 2024-06-28 EDT 5-day change 1st Jan Change
44.6 GBX +1.13% Intraday chart for Schroder Real Estate Investment Trust Limited -1.33% +0.22%

Valuation

Fiscal Period: März 2019 2020 2021 2022 2023 2024
Capitalization 1 287.3 201.4 196.1 283.8 213 204.9
Enterprise Value (EV) 1 422.4 299.5 339.3 436 383.2 376.4
P/E ratio 18.1 x -6.21 x 44.7 x 3.18 x -3.9 x 67.9 x
Yield 4.61% 5.33% 5.62% 5.13% 7.49% 8.02%
Capitalization / Revenue 10 x 8.15 x 8.2 x 10.7 x 7.43 x 7.23 x
EV / Revenue 14.8 x 12.1 x 14.2 x 16.4 x 13.4 x 13.3 x
EV / EBITDA - - - - - -
EV / FCF -17.1 x 5.07 x 48 x 35.3 x 54.3 x 26.8 x
FCF Yield -5.85% 19.7% 2.08% 2.83% 1.84% 3.73%
Price to Book 0.81 x 0.65 x 0.66 x 0.76 x 0.71 x 0.71 x
Nbr of stocks (in thousands) 518,513 518,513 491,419 491,080 489,111 489,111
Reference price 2 0.5540 0.3885 0.3990 0.5780 0.4355 0.4190
Announcement Date 19-05-21 20-06-09 21-06-02 22-06-07 23-06-08 24-06-06
1GBP in Million2GBP
Estimates

Income Statement Evolution (Annual data)

Fiscal Period: March 2019 2020 2021 2022 2023 2024
Net sales 1 28.59 24.73 23.91 26.6 28.69 28.34
EBITDA - - - - - -
EBIT 1 21.96 18.5 16.58 20.75 21.98 22.28
Operating Margin 76.8% 74.82% 69.32% 78% 76.63% 78.61%
Earnings before Tax (EBT) 1 15.9 -32.46 4.542 89.37 -54.72 3.017
Net income 1 15.9 -32.46 4.542 89.37 -54.72 3.017
Net margin 55.62% -131.27% 19% 335.98% -190.74% 10.65%
EPS 2 0.0307 -0.0626 0.008928 0.1820 -0.1117 0.006168
Free Cash Flow 1 -24.7 59.01 7.072 12.34 7.062 14.03
FCF margin -86.4% 238.65% 29.58% 46.38% 24.62% 49.5%
FCF Conversion (EBITDA) - - - - - -
FCF Conversion (Net income) - - 155.71% 13.8% - 464.91%
Dividend per Share 2 0.0256 0.0207 0.0224 0.0297 0.0326 0.0336
Announcement Date 19-05-21 20-06-09 21-06-02 22-06-07 23-06-08 24-06-06
1GBP in Million2GBP
Estimates

Balance Sheet Analysis

Fiscal Period: March 2019 2020 2021 2022 2023 2024
Net Debt 1 135 98 143 152 170 171
Net Cash position 1 - - - - - -
Leverage (Debt/EBITDA) - - - - - -
Free Cash Flow 1 -24.7 59 7.07 12.3 7.06 14
ROE (net income / shareholders' equity) 4.48% -9.74% 1.5% 26.7% -16.3% 1.03%
ROA (Net income/ Total Assets) 2.66% 2.39% 2.28% 2.58% 2.65% 2.88%
Assets 1 598.1 -1,361 199 3,464 -2,061 104.9
Book Value Per Share 2 0.6900 0.6000 0.6000 0.7600 0.6100 0.5900
Cash Flow per Share 2 0.0400 0.0600 0.0200 0.0200 0.0200 0.0100
Capex - - - - - -
Capex / Sales - - - - - -
Announcement Date 19-05-21 20-06-09 21-06-02 22-06-07 23-06-08 24-06-06
1GBP in Million2GBP
Estimates

EPS & Dividend

Year-on-year evolution of the PER

Change in Enterprise Value/EBITDA

  1. Stock Market
  2. Equities
  3. SREI Stock
  4. Financials Schroder Real Estate Investment Trust Limited